## Who to ping about GiftNote

Welcome aboard! GiftNote is our donation-receipt mailer for the Larchfield Fund. Template tweaks go to the comms folks; delivery failures and bounce weirdness go to the platform crew. Don't push template changes on Fridays — receipts batch over the weekend. For anything GiftNote-related, start with the address below.

billing contact of kaweg-tajeg = drudor.lamion.oliath@torvalabs.test

Subject: Tolvane licensing dispute — board briefing

Dear executive team,

Tolvane Analytics has formally contested our continued use of the Quillbridge engine, citing an expired territorial clause. We have retained outside counsel, preserved all correspondence, and paused the affected deployments pending review. Exposure is estimated at one quarter's margin on the Ardleigh product line. The broader implications for our strategy are summarised below.

internal memo for kaduf-baduf: Only 35 of the 378 pilot accounts renewed Holir, so a churn review is set for June 11. Eliielax Group is in early talks to buy Silaelix Group for about $142.1 million.

## Migration Step 4: GraphLattice v3

Plugin authors: GraphLattice v3 drops the legacy edge-walker API. Replace all `walkEdges` calls with the streaming `traverse` interface before upgrading. Node metadata is now lazy-loaded; do not assume labels are present at render time. Rebuild your plugin manifest against the v3 schema and re-register with the Veldrin plugin registry. Layout hints moved from annotations to config. The renderer will refuse unsigned manifests. Apply the following configuration values to your staging instance first.

service settings:
[casax]
port = 6379
team = rusir
host = casax.zemvarhq.corp
region = outer-4
access_code = ac_9808ce
timeout_ms = 1500